#2e6203 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2e6203 is composed of 18% red, 38.4%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.9%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 92.8 degrees, a saturation of 94.1% and a lightness of 19.8%. #2e6203 color hex could be obtained by blending #5cc406 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

#2e6203 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2e6203 has RGB values of R:46, G:98,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 3039747.
